logo

Output 8568f86adf4da920e37620aa783638628362abe62e70fe6392e6b293598f97a9:2

value
18650400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d03c37abacaf9626b7608d2830a48e679b6c4f45 OP_EQUAL
address
3Lg4cRjHoWut9A3ajCHRT1zrftuNcuJuPL
transaction
8568f86adf4da920e37620aa783638628362abe62e70fe6392e6b293598f97a9